Hi everyone, I'm new to this board - just wanted to get some help with something that happened today

I have a 92' accord EX 4dr in excellent condition. I never had a problem with the cig socket before but today, when I plugged my cd player adapter, it suddenly stopped working. Here's the thing, I've been using this portable CD player for a year with no problems because my decks have been stolen repeatedly. Anyways, I had to unplug the adapter to let my sister borrow it and when I got it back, it broke. I think there was some aluminum foil on it (don't ask me how it got there, it just did). It works when the car's engine is turned on, but when somethings plugged in the socket, the defroster blinks and doesn't work and I get the 'door ajar' sound. My interior light doesn't work anymore and my upper signal lights don't work (parking lights work still). Also, when I turn off my car and try to close my windows, It won't work. I think it's because it says my trunk is still opened but when the engine is running, the car says the drunk is closed.

Soo here's the break down:
Key in the ignition for electric - Cigarette socket does not work
Key turned once more - Cigarette socket does not work, whenever I push something in, the car says the trunk is open. Everything else seems to work
Engine running while something plugged in socket - defroster blinks or does not turn on, door ajar sound goes off
Engine w/o anything plugged in - everything seems to work


There might be some more stuff I probably overlooked but that's just what happened today. I think it might be the fuse that was blown or something but it's affected a bunch of the things I stated above. Any ideas about what's going on and what I should do? I'm not very handy with electronics but I can probably get some help or should I just bring it to the dealer? Thanks in advance

Have you tried plugging anything else into the lighter plug? Cell Phone charger?

It could be somthing in the adapter for the CD player shorting out the electrical in the car, that could be what is making it goofy. There might not be enough blow the fuse, but it could be enough to screw up the electrical.

If you can try plugging something else into the lighter plug and see if you get the same results.

Check all your fuses as well... then visually inspect the cig lighter with a flashlight to make sure it's free from metal debrie that could be shorting it out... (I knew someone with and Oldsmobile and her son put a penny in the cig lighter and the door locks stoped working so it very well could be a short...) Then as was mentioned try it with something besides the CD player plugged in and let us know the results...

did you check all your fuses? if you have an they are ok I would try to remove the cigarette lighter fuse so it's disconnected and test everything. if that works fine then I would replace the cigarette lighter..

I checked my fuse box at my kick panel and under the hood. Nothing was wrong inside the kick panel but there was one blown fuse under the hood labeled "interior light". Replaced it with one of the spares and tested everything. Worked like a charm, everything is back to normal! Thanks everyone :)
